Purpose of the role
To control assigned day to day activities within the warehouse including receipt and checking of products, issue and dispatch of
products, product storage and stock rotation as specified. This position will also carry out additional duties as instructed by
Warehouse Team Leaders, Shift Managers, Warehouse Manager or Operations Manager. To ensure that all areas of operational
responsibility comply with all Company, legal, environmental, ISO, security and Health and Safety procedures and standards. To
ensure all documentation is completed accurately and returned promptly to the Team Leader.
Key Responsibilities
Comply with procedures and guidelines and ensure that performance standards are met.
Receive, check, and locate products in compliance to procedures and instructions.
Pick and pack products in compliance with procedures and customer requirements.
Adhere to work instructions.
Suggest and contribute to any improvement initiatives.
Assume responsibility for functions specified by the Warehouse Team Leader
Ensure that all documentation pertinent to the function is forwarded to the relevant department.
Notify the Warehouse Team Leader of deviations to procedures.
Maintain a high standard of housekeeping.
Complete the daily mechanical handling checklist (MHE users only)
Ensure that working practices conform to health and safety standards.
Experience/Skills Required
Able to work at pace and deliver a quality result at all times.
Able to work within a team and individually.
Flexibility.
High attention to detail.
Previous experience within a fast-paced parcel sortation or fulfilment environment.
Trained on PPT, LLOP and or Forklift (desirable)
First aid trained (desirable)
